摘要

目的 水基纳米流体静电雾化借助高压静电场将荷电雾滴定向输送至加工区,可有效提高流体利用率,改善加工性能。然而目前尚未对水基纳米流体静电雾化切削性能进行研究,缺乏对其与荷电、润湿性能关联的认识,亟待开展相关工作。方法 测试了氧化石墨烯水基纳米流体静电雾化的模式、荷电及润湿性能,采用单因素与正交试验方法进行铝合金切削试验,研究了电压、氧化石墨烯含量及流量对切削力和切削区表面温度的影响,并利用信噪比和灰色关联度分析方法优化了氧化石墨烯含量、流量和切削速度,以有效减力降温。结果 与去离子水静电雾化相比,氧化石墨烯水基纳米流体静电雾化的切削力与切削区表面温度分别减小1.59%~6.71%和0.54%~13.87%。荷电与润湿性能、雾化分散性及氧化石墨烯水基纳米流体的流动性和分散性共同影响切削力和切削区表面温度随电压和氧化石墨烯含量的变化趋势。就降低减力降温的综合效果而言,最优的氧化石墨烯含量(体积分数)、流量及切削速度分别为0.3%、5 mL/h和353 m/min。最优参数下的刀具磨损和加工表面粗糙度较去离子水和LB2000植物性润滑油静电雾化分别降低27.8%~30.8%和7.7%~31.5%。结论 添加的氧化石墨烯不仅改善静电雾化效果和润湿性能,而且在切削表面可沉积形成润滑层,从而改善铝合金切削的加工性能。

Abstract

Water-based nanofluid electrostatic spray can effectively improve the utilization rate of water-based nanofluids and enhance the processing performance by using high-voltage electrostatic field to transport charged droplets to the processing area. However, at present, the electrostatic spray cutting performance using water-based nanofluids has not been studied, and there is a lack of understanding of its relationship with charging performance and wettability. Therefore, it is urgent to carry out relevant works. The mode, charging performance, and wettability for electrostatic spray using graphene oxide water-based nanofluids are tested in this work. The single factor and orthogonal test methods are used to carry out the electrostatic spray cutting of aluminum alloy with graphene oxide water-based nanofluids. Based on the test results of spray current and charged droplet's surface tension and contact angle, the effects of voltage, graphene oxide content, and flow rate on cutting force and surface temperature of the cutting zone are studied. The graphene oxide content, flow rate, and cutting speed are optimized by using signal-to-noise ratio and grey correlation analysis method, so as to reduce the force and the temperature effectively. In addition, the tool wear test and machined surface quality inspection for electrostatic spray cutting with deionized water, graphene oxide water-based nanofluid, and LB2000 vegetable lubricating oil under the optimal parameters are carried out to further confirm the processing effect of the optimal parameters. The spray test results show that conical jet is a spray mode for continuous cooling and lubrication of cutting edges. The spray current of electrostatic spray using graphene oxide water-based nanofluids is higher than that of deionized water electrostatic spray, while the surface tension and contact angle of charged droplets are lower compared with deionized water electrostatic spray. The increase of voltage, graphene oxide content, and flow rate can easily lead to the improvement of charging performance and wettability. The single factor cutting test results indicate that compared with deionized water electrostatic spray, the cutting force and surface temperature of the cutting zone for electrostatic spray using graphene oxide water-based nanofluids are reduced by 1.59%-6.71% and 0.54%-13.87%, respectively. The changing trends of cutting force and surface temperature in the cutting zone with voltage and graphene oxide content are affected by the charging and wetting properties, spray dispersion, and the fluidity and dispersion of graphene oxide water-based nanofluids. The signal-to-noise ratio and grey correlation analysis for the orthogonal experimental results suggest that in terms of the comprehensive effect of reducing the cutting force and the surface temperature of the cutting zone, the optimal graphene oxide content, flow rate, and cutting speed are 0.3vol.%, 5 mL/h, and 353 m/min, respectively. Compared with deionized water electrostatic spray and LB2000 vegetable oil electrostatic spray, the tool wear and machined surface roughness under the optimal parameters are lowered by 27.8%-30.8% and 7.7%-31.5%, respectively. The addition of graphene oxide not only improves the electrostatic spray effect and wettability, but also deposits on the cutting surface to form a lubricating layer, thus improving the cooling and lubrication performance and consequently enhancing the processing performance of aluminum alloy cutting.
